Job title: Electrician: Mechanic A Department: Property Management Reports to: Senior Director of Maintenance and Repair Employment status: Non-exempt Union status: Local 3 Shift: Monday - Friday 7:30AM to 4:00PM The Brooklyn Navy Yard Development Corporation (BNYDC) is a not-for-profit corporation that serves as the real estate developer and property manager of the Yard on behalf of its owner, the City of New York. BNYDC strives to provide an environment in which innovative companies can take root and grow. We are seeking an Electrician to join our team to install, repair, and maintain electrical wiring, equipment, and fixtures throughout our facilities. Areas of Responsibility • Install, repair, and maintain electrical wiring systems and components, equipment and apparatuses such as switchgear, transformers, conduit, circuit breakers & panels, outlets, lighting systems, and motors in accordance with NYC electrical code • Splice wires up to 500 MCM at 600V • Conduct testing and troubleshooting of new and existing installations up to 600V to determine faults or hazards • Perform standard computations relating to electrical load requirements of wiring • Work with industry-specific hand tools, power tools, and testing equipment • Interpret blueprints and technical diagrams • Label system components • Collaborate cross-functionally with team members while also demonstrating accountability in completing tasks independently • Maintain good housekeeping of work sites, electrical rooms, tools, and equipment • Performs other duties as assigned The above duties and responsibilities are not intended to limit specific duties and responsibilities of this position. It is not intended to limit in any way the authority of supervisors to assign, direct and control the work of employees under their supervision. Qualifications • Vocational or trade school training preferred • 5+ years related work experience required • Valid driver’s license required • Knowledge of building electrical codes required • OSHA 10 / OSHA 30 preferred • SST certification preferred • Strong understanding of NEC and NFPA 70E guidelines Expected hours: No less than 40 per week Work Location: In person
